comparemela.com
Home
Convent Phillip Neri
Top Locations Tagged with Convent Phillip Neri
Convent Phillip Neri in India - 673611/School near kozhikode/School near Kozhikode
1). Phillip Neri Convent School
vimarsana © 2020. All Rights Reserved.